“Rebel Girls Lead: 25 Tales of Powerful Women” is a book of some very successful and powerful women from our history. All of them are true stories and real women: A gymnast and team captain, a chancellor, a queen, a CEO, a basketball coach, a climate activist and so on. In the book 25 incredible women are displayed along with a description of the way they have influenced the world.

Along with the stories, there are beautiful illustrations of the women. And there is even room for you to write and draw your own personal story. How cool is that!

And there is a small quiz, where you can find out what kind of leader you are.

This is a true inspirational book for all of the young girls out there. It is very cute!

In this volume of rebel girls, short stories are presented about the lives of 25 women who were or are leaders in the world, but not only political leaders, but athletes and artists as well, who stand out in what they do or did.

The information is quite basic, sometimes it seems that it does not have a chronological order and in some narratives it has errors. The most notable is the one they do with Queen Elizabeth I, saying that she and her brother Edward were Jane’s children, when her mother was Anne Boleyn.

Another notable thing is that most of these women are from the United States of America and there is not much diversity among them either.

There is one thing that seems to me a mistake and almost an offense, for the culture, as for Mexican women and it is: "Once upon a time there was a girl who didn't want to make tortillas" like what? It seems stereotypical and offensive to me (and I am a Mexican woman).

I would not say that it is a good book, but this is my opinion, I am not a mother, nor am I the target of this book.
